Transaction 56c72a5770297223eade4f4c848ffc4a1643a5d478e7dfebaf00373e376dbf91

85 Input
2 Outputs
  • 56c72a5770297223eade4f4c848ffc4a1643a5d478e7dfebaf00373e376dbf91:0
  • value  2250530563
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 56c72a5770297223eade4f4c848ffc4a1643a5d478e7dfebaf00373e376dbf91:1
  • value  606124
    address  3HrNUpHKMqECVgzAoZ9eDhLdjawqaWWQyN